For these with chronic kidney disease (CKD) or decreased kidney operate, monitoring phosphate intake is paramount. The kidneys play an important function in phosphorus regulation, and compromised kidney perform can result in the inability to correctly filter and take away excess phosphorus from the blood. This could lead to hyperphosphatemia, a condition characterized by elevated phosphorus ranges within the blood, which has been associated with an elevated risk of coronary heart illness and bone disorders.
